- Sound, Cheshire
Sound is a hamlet (at SJ 619 483) and
civil parish in theCrewe and Nantwich district ofCheshire ,England . The village is located 3¼ miles to the south west ofNantwich . The parish also includes the settlements of Newtown and Sound Heath. [ [http://www.ukbmd.org.uk/genuki/chs/sound.html Genuki: Sound] (accessed 14 August 2007)] Nearby villages include Aston,Ravensmoor andWrenbury . The Welsh Marches railway line runs north–south through the parish and the A530 runs along its south-east edge.The parish includes the heathland
Site of Special Scientific Interest ofSound Heath . [ [http://www.english-nature.org.uk/citation/citation_photo/1007131.pdf English Nature: Sound Heath] ]According to the 2001 census, the parish had a population of 233.
